Austreng Leads Field After Two Rounds at Horizon League Championship
April 28, 2008
LEBANON, Ohio - Junior Adam Austreng has a one-stroke lead after firing a three-under 141 through two rounds Monday at the 2008 Horizon League Men's Golf Championship at Shaker Run Golf Course, hosted by Wright State University. Austreng went two-under on the par-72 course in the day's first round, despite a double bogey on his first hole. He recovered thanks to an eagle on the par-5 eighth hole and tallied nine birdies through 36 holes. Austreng leads Butler's Kyle Thomas by one stroke and has a two-stroke lead on both Jake Scott and Kent Monas of Cleveland State. Green Bay is currently fifth of seven teams heading into the final 18 holes Tuesday. The Phoenix is three strokes from fourth-place Butler and 10 strokes back of Youngstown State in third place. Cleveland State leads Detroit by three strokes for the top spot. Garrett Gosh is tied for 15th after an unfortunate end to his second round, where he lost six strokes in his final two holes to finish with a 79. Brady Mork is one stroke behind Gosh in a tie for 19th with an 11-over 155, while Carson Solien is tied for 30th with a 15-over 159. Travis Meyer is 33rd with an 18-over 162.
